services:
# PostgreSQL Database for Nextcloud
nextcloud-db:
image: postgres:16-alpine
container_name: nextcloud-db
restart: unless-stopped
volumes:
- nextcloud-db-data:/var/lib/postgresql/data
environment:
POSTGRES_DB: {{ nextcloud_db_name }}
POSTGRES_USER: {{ nextcloud_db_user }}
POSTGRES_PASSWORD: {{ client_secrets.nextcloud_db_password }}
POSTGRES_INITDB_ARGS: "--auth-host=scram-sha-256"
command: >
postgres
-c shared_buffers=256MB
-c max_connections=200
-c shared_preload_libraries=''
healthcheck:
test: ["CMD-SHELL", "pg_isready -U {{ nextcloud_db_user }} -d {{ nextcloud_db_name }}"]
interval: 10s
timeout: 5s
retries: 5
networks:
- nextcloud-internal
# Redis for caching and file locking
nextcloud-redis:
image: redis:7-alpine
container_name: nextcloud-redis
restart: unless-stopped
command: redis-server --save 60 1 --loglevel warning
volumes:
- nextcloud-redis-data:/data
networks:
- nextcloud-internal
# Nextcloud cron (separate container for background jobs)
nextcloud-cron:
image: nextcloud:{{ nextcloud_version }}
container_name: nextcloud-cron
restart: unless-stopped
depends_on:
- nextcloud-db
- nextcloud-redis
volumes:
- nextcloud-app:/var/www/html
- /mnt/nextcloud-data/data:/var/www/html/data # User data on Hetzner Volume
entrypoint: /cron.sh
networks:
- nextcloud-internal
# Nextcloud application
nextcloud:
image: nextcloud:{{ nextcloud_version }}
container_name: nextcloud
restart: unless-stopped
depends_on:
- nextcloud-db
- nextcloud-redis
volumes:
- nextcloud-app:/var/www/html
- /mnt/nextcloud-data/data:/var/www/html/data # User data on Hetzner Volume
environment:
# Database configuration
POSTGRES_HOST: {{ nextcloud_db_host }}
POSTGRES_DB: {{ nextcloud_db_name }}
POSTGRES_USER: {{ nextcloud_db_user }}
POSTGRES_PASSWORD: {{ client_secrets.nextcloud_db_password }}
# Redis configuration
REDIS_HOST: {{ nextcloud_redis_host }}
REDIS_HOST_PORT: {{ nextcloud_redis_port }}
# Nextcloud configuration
NEXTCLOUD_ADMIN_USER: {{ nextcloud_admin_user }}
NEXTCLOUD_ADMIN_PASSWORD: {{ client_secrets.nextcloud_admin_password }}
NEXTCLOUD_TRUSTED_DOMAINS: {{ nextcloud_domain }}
OVERWRITEPROTOCOL: https
OVERWRITEHOST: {{ nextcloud_domain }}
OVERWRITECLIURL: https://{{ nextcloud_domain }}
# PHP configuration
PHP_MEMORY_LIMIT: {{ nextcloud_php_memory_limit }}
PHP_UPLOAD_LIMIT: {{ nextcloud_php_upload_limit }}
# SMTP configuration (optional, can be configured via OIDC later)
# SMTP_HOST:
# SMTP_SECURE:
# SMTP_PORT:
# SMTP_NAME:
# SMTP_PASSWORD:
# MAIL_FROM_ADDRESS:
# MAIL_DOMAIN:
networks:
- traefik
- nextcloud-internal
labels:
- "traefik.enable=true"
- "traefik.docker.network=traefik"
# HTTP Router
- "traefik.http.routers.nextcloud.rule=Host(`{{ nextcloud_domain }}`)"
- "traefik.http.routers.nextcloud.entrypoints=websecure"
- "traefik.http.routers.nextcloud.tls=true"
- "traefik.http.routers.nextcloud.tls.certresolver=letsencrypt"
# Middleware for Nextcloud
- "traefik.http.routers.nextcloud.middlewares=nextcloud-headers,nextcloud-redirectregex"
# Security headers
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-headers.headers.stsSeconds=31536000"
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-headers.headers.stsIncludeSubdomains=true"
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-headers.headers.stsPreload=true"
# CalDAV/CardDAV redirect
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-redirectregex.redirectregex.permanent=true"
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-redirectregex.redirectregex.regex=https://(.*)/.well-known/(card|cal)dav"
- "traefik.http.middlewares.nextcloud-redirectregex.redirectregex.replacement=https://$$1/remote.php/dav/"
# Service
- "traefik.http.services.nextcloud.loadbalancer.server.port=80"
# Collabora Office (online document editing)
collabora:
image: collabora/code:latest
container_name: collabora
restart: unless-stopped
# Required capabilities for optimal performance (bind-mount instead of copy)
cap_add:
- MKNOD
- SYS_CHROOT
environment:
- domain={{ nextcloud_domain | regex_replace('\.', '\\.') }}
- username={{ collabora_admin_user }}
- password={{ client_secrets.collabora_admin_password }}
# Performance tuning based on available CPU cores
# num_prespawn_children: Number of child processes to keep started (default: 1)
# per_document.max_concurrency: Max threads per document (should be <= CPU cores)
- extra_params=--o:ssl.enable=false --o:ssl.termination=true --o:num_prespawn_children=1 --o:per_document.max_concurrency=2
- MEMPROPORTION=60.0
- MAX_DOCUMENTS=10
- MAX_CONNECTIONS=20
deploy:
resources:
limits:
memory: 1g
cpus: '2'
reservations:
memory: 512m
networks:
- traefik
- nextcloud-internal
labels:
- "traefik.enable=true"
- "traefik.docker.network=traefik"
# HTTP Router
- "traefik.http.routers.collabora.rule=Host(`{{ collabora_domain }}`)"
- "traefik.http.routers.collabora.entrypoints=websecure"
- "traefik.http.routers.collabora.tls=true"
- "traefik.http.routers.collabora.tls.certresolver=letsencrypt"
# Service
- "traefik.http.services.collabora.loadbalancer.server.port=9980"
networks:
traefik:
external: true
nextcloud-internal:
name: nextcloud-internal
driver: bridge
volumes:
nextcloud-db-data:
name: nextcloud-db-data
nextcloud-redis-data:
name: nextcloud-redis-data
nextcloud-app:
name: nextcloud-app
# Note: nextcloud-data volume removed - user data now stored on Hetzner Volume at /mnt/nextcloud-data
